Understanding Light Distribution
Light distribution refers to how evenly light is spread over the plant area. Uneven light can lead to problems such as leggy plants, uneven growth, or areas of stagnation. To prevent this, it’s important to understand the characteristics of your grow lights and how they emit light.
Strategies for Optimal Light Placement
- Maintain Proper Distance: Keep lights at an optimal height above the plants. Too close can cause hotspots and leaf burn, while too far reduces light intensity.
- Use Reflective Surfaces: Incorporate reflective materials like Mylar or white paint to bounce light and fill in shaded areas.
- Adjust Light Angles: Tilt or angle lights to cover uneven areas and avoid direct overlaps that cause hotspots.
- Implement Light Meters: Use light meters to measure intensity at various points and adjust accordingly for uniform coverage.
- Distribute Lights Evenly: Position multiple lights evenly across the grow area rather than clustering them in one spot.
Monitoring and Adjusting Light Placement
Regular monitoring is key to maintaining even light distribution. Use light meters to check the intensity at different points. If certain areas receive less light, consider repositioning lights or adding additional fixtures. Keep an eye on plant responses and adjust as needed to optimize growth conditions.
